So here I sit... Making a blog entry on my first avatar in Second Life. When and if you notice, she's awefully dead looking and probably morbid to most of you. Fantasy yes, Barbie Starr originated in a strange way. I was practically begged into SL. And came here in disbelief of how I could actually make it in a meta-verse: A chat world with graphics. Coming from collarme.com, a mux called "Passion and Pain" I used to roleplay BDSM on and just plain old yahoo chat, where people could randomly IM you because of your profile(I left yahoo because of the several message ever morning that crashed my pc. So if any of you old yahoo buddies see this, just drop me a line at this address) was a big change for me. In 2006, I landed in SL and I had to pick a name out. My friend had told me to come over and over and over... and finally she said: "You can make money!" and though I am not a ProDomme, I do make money on the net. Most of my adult RL has always involved e-commerce, so when she said this I was on it! So I go to sign up in June of '06.

So, back to getting into Second Life... Here I sat at the screen and I have my own last name... and I am like "What the hell... I have to pick a last name from a list (rolleyes)." So as I sit there I am thinking.. "Oh this is a crock. I am not gonna stay in here." So I see the last name Ringo first.. and I think "Oh, Ringo Starr..." then I see Starr and I am like "Oh cool.. hrm Barbara Starr..." (Obviously I didnt want to be the CNN newscaster) So I said "Ok, Barbie Starr..." So, there you have it... Barbie Starr was born into SL. The first place I went was my friends sim: City of Tharnia(actually I now own this sim too under a different name). He is a very dear friend to me, a Master online that I have known for many years, and someone who respects me for my FemDom Lifestyle. We met in 2004, on the mux that I was playing on. I used to Roleplay the Slave Master there, in an evil land. I met a lot of my slaves that came with me to Second Life and stayed with me from that mux.
Braeden Kuhr, was kind enough to open his sim up to my slaves and I. Of course, being a FemDom, I ventured off looking for people in the FemDom Realm.
